Assault rate of Armenia sank by 18.06% from 6.6 cases per 100,000 population in 2014 to 5.4 cases per 100,000 population in 2015. Since the 11.57% jump in 2013, assault rate slumped by 8.16% in 2015.
The description is composed by our digital data assistant.'Assault' means physical attack against the body of another person resulting in serious bodily injury; excluding indecent/sexual assault; threats and slapping/punching. 'Assault' leading to death should also be excluded. (UN-CTS M3.2)
| Date | Value | Change, % |
|---|---|---|
| 2015 | 5.4 | -18.06% |
| 2014 | 6.6 | 12.07% |
| 2013 | 5.9 | 11.57% |
| 2012 | 5.3 | -2.77% |
| 2011 | 5.4 | 3.63% |
| 2010 | 5.2 | -6.61% |
| 2009 | 5.6 | -17.16% |
| 2008 | 6.8 | 23.13% |
| 2007 | 5.5 | -7.42% |
| 2006 | 5.9 | -0.67% |
| 2005 | 6.0 | -4.94% |
| 2004 | 6.3 |
